For general searching issues in Windows 7 , you could try clicking on Start > Computer > Organize > Folder and Search Options > View Tab > Advanced Settings > Hidden Files and Folders > and tick "Show Hidden Files, Folders and Drives . Click OK, then use Start > Search Programs and Files... to find keywords from the documents that are missing. There would be similar techniques of revealing hidden files for other versions of Windows.
